const assign = require("object-assign");
const babel = require("babel-core");
const loaderUtils = require("loader-utils");
const path = require("path");
const cache = require("./fs-cache.js");
const exists = require("./utils/exists")();
const relative = require("./utils/relative");
const read = require("./utils/read")();
const resolveRc = require("./resolve-rc.js");
const pkg = require("./../package.json");
/**
* Error thrown by Babel formatted to conform to Webpack reporting.
*/
function BabelLoaderError(name, message, codeFrame, hideStack, error) {
Error.call(this);
Error.captureStackTrace(this, BabelLoaderError);
this.name = "BabelLoaderError";
this.message = formatMessage(name, message, codeFrame);
this.hideStack = hideStack;
this.error = error;
}
BabelLoaderError.prototype = Object.create(Error.prototype);
BabelLoaderError.prototype.constructor = BabelLoaderError;
const STRIP_FILENAME_RE = /^[^:]+: /;
const formatMessage = function(name, message, codeFrame) {
return (name ? name + ": " : "") + message + "\n\n" + codeFrame + "\n";
};
const transpile = function(source, options) {
const forceEnv = options.forceEnv;
let tmpEnv;
delete options.forceEnv;
if (forceEnv) {
tmpEnv = process.env.BABEL_ENV;
process.env.BABEL_ENV = forceEnv;
}
let result;
try {
result = babel.transform(source, options);
} catch (error) {
if (forceEnv) process.env.BABEL_ENV = tmpEnv;
if (error.message && error.codeFrame) {
let message = error.message;
let name;
let hideStack;
if (error instanceof SyntaxError) {
message = message.replace(STRIP_FILENAME_RE, "");
name = "SyntaxError";
hideStack = true;
} else if (error instanceof TypeError) {
message = message.replace(STRIP_FILENAME_RE, "");
hideStack = true;
}
throw new BabelLoaderError(
name, message, error.codeFrame, hideStack, error);
} else {
throw error;
}
}
const code = result.code;
const map = result.map;
const metadata = result.metadata;
if (map && (!map.sourcesContent || !map.sourcesContent.length)) {
map.sourcesContent = [source];
}
if (forceEnv) process.env.BABEL_ENV = tmpEnv;
return {
code: code,
map: map,
metadata: metadata,
};
};
function passMetadata(s, context, metadata) {
if (context[s]) {
context[s](metadata);
}
}
module.exports = function(source, inputSourceMap) {
// Handle filenames (#106)
const webpackRemainingChain = loaderUtils.getRemainingRequest(this).split("!");
const filename = webpackRemainingChain[webpackRemainingChain.length - 1];
// Handle options
const globalOptions = this.options.babel || {};
const loaderOptions = loaderUtils.parseQuery(this.query);
const userOptions = assign({}, globalOptions, loaderOptions);
const defaultOptions = {
metadataSubscribers: [],
inputSourceMap: inputSourceMap,
sourceRoot: process.cwd(),
filename: filename,
cacheIdentifier: JSON.stringify({
"babel-loader": pkg.version,
"babel-core": babel.version,
babelrc: exists(userOptions.babelrc) ?
read(userOptions.babelrc) :
resolveRc(path.dirname(filename)),
env: userOptions.forceEnv || process.env.BABEL_ENV || process.env.NODE_ENV || "development",
}),
};
const options = assign({}, defaultOptions, userOptions);
if (userOptions.sourceMap === undefined) {
options.sourceMap = this.sourceMap;
}
if (options.sourceFileName === undefined) {
options.sourceFileName = relative(
options.sourceRoot,
options.filename
);
}
const cacheDirectory = options.cacheDirectory;
const cacheIdentifier = options.cacheIdentifier;
const metadataSubscribers = options.metadataSubscribers;
delete options.cacheDirectory;
delete options.cacheIdentifier;
delete options.metadataSubscribers;
this.cacheable();
const context = this;
if (cacheDirectory) {
const callback = this.async();
return cache({
directory: cacheDirectory,
identifier: cacheIdentifier,
source: source,
options: options,
transform: transpile,
}, function(err, result) {
if (err) { return callback(err); }
metadataSubscribers.forEach(function (s) {
passMetadata(s, context, result.metadata);
});
return callback(null, result.code, result.map);
});
}
const result = transpile(source, options);
metadataSubscribers.forEach(function (s) {
passMetadata(s, context, result.metadata);
});
this.callback(null, result.code, result.map);
};
